Hot Water Runs Out Too Quickly
If showers turn cold faster than usual, the heating element or gas burner may not be working properly. Water heater repair can restore full heating capacity.
Rust-Colored or Smelly Water
Discolored water may mean corrosion inside the tank. A plumber can inspect the anode rod and recommend repairs before the tank fails.
Water Around the Base of the Heater
Pooling water often comes from loose fittings, pressure relief valve issues, or cracked tanks. Leak detection helps find the exact cause.
Unusual Banging or Popping Sounds
Sediment buildup at the bottom of the tank can harden and cause loud noises. Flushing and professional repair can improve heating efficiency.

Gas and electric water heaters operate differently and require specialized plumbing knowledge. Gas water heaters depend on burners, pilot lights, and ventilation systems. Electric units rely on heating elements, thermostats, and safe wiring. When one of these components fails, hot water becomes unreliable. Professional water heater repair in La Palma, CA includes testing safety controls, checking gas supply lines, and inspecting electrical connections. A licensed plumber ensures repairs meet safety standards and prevent future breakdowns.
Repairing Gas Water Heater Burners and Valves
If your pilot light keeps going out or the burner does not ignite, the thermocouple or gas valve may need replacement. Proper repair restores safe heating.
Fixing Electric Heating Elements and Thermostats
A burned-out heating element can cause lukewarm water. Replacing faulty elements and recalibrating thermostats improves water temperature.
Pressure Relief Valve and Plumbing Connection Repairs
Loose plumbing fittings and failing relief valves can lead to leaks. Tightening connections and replacing damaged parts prevents water damage.

Tankless water heaters are popular in La Palma, CA because they provide hot water on demand and use less energy. However, these systems require proper maintenance and skilled repair when issues occur. Hard water minerals can clog internal parts and reduce efficiency. If your tankless unit displays error codes, shuts off suddenly, or struggles to keep up with demand, professional repair is needed. A plumbing contractor can clean heat exchangers, test sensors, and restore reliable hot water flow.
Descaling Tankless Systems for Better Performance
Mineral buildup reduces heating power. Descaling removes deposits and helps the system heat water faster and more efficiently.
Sensor and Venting Troubleshooting
Blocked vents or faulty sensors can trigger safety shutdowns. A trained plumber inspects airflow and replaces malfunctioning parts.

Many homeowners ask whether water heater repair or full replacement is better. Repair works well when the tank is under 10 years old and corrosion is limited. Replacement may be necessary if the tank leaks from the bottom or shows heavy rust. A plumbing contractor can perform a detailed inspection and explain options clearly. Choosing the right solution improves energy efficiency and prevents repeat breakdowns.
When Repair Is the Smart Choice
Minor part failures like thermostats, valves, and heating elements can be replaced at lower cost than installing a new unit.
When Replacement Provides Long-Term Value
If repair costs continue to rise and the tank is aging, upgrading to a modern system may save money over time.

Preventive Maintenance Tips to Extend Water Heater Life
Simple maintenance helps prevent emergency plumbing calls and extends the life of your water heater. Regular service keeps heating components clean and operating efficiently.
Flush the Tank Annually
Removing sediment improves heating performance and lowers energy bills.
Test the Pressure Relief Valve
Checking this valve ensures safe operation and prevents excess pressure buildup.
Schedule a Yearly Plumbing Inspection
A professional inspection catches small issues before they become expensive plumbing repairs.
